package edu.stanford.nlp.trees.treebank; import edu.stanford.nlp.util.logging.Redwood; import java.io.*; import java.util.List; import java.util.ArrayList; import edu.stanford.nlp.io.FileSystem; import edu.stanford.nlp.util.RuntimeInterruptedException; /** * Adds data files to a tar'd / gzip'd distribution package. Data sets marked with the DISTRIB parameter * in {@link ConfigParser} are added to the archive. * * @author Spence Green */ public class DistributionPackage { /** A logger for this class */ private static Redwood.RedwoodChannels log = Redwood.channels(DistributionPackage.class); private final List<String> distFiles; private String lastCreatedDistribution = "UNKNOWN"; public DistributionPackage() { distFiles = new ArrayList<>(); } /** * Adds a listing of files to the distribution archive * * @param fileList List of full file paths */ public void addFiles(List<String> fileList) { distFiles.addAll(fileList); } /** * Create the distribution and name the file according to the specified parameter. * * @param distribName The name of distribution * @return True if the distribution is built. False otherwise. */ public boolean make(String distribName) { boolean createdDir = (new File(distribName)).mkdir(); if(createdDir) { String currentFile = ""; try { for(String filename : distFiles) { currentFile = filename; File destFile = new File(filename); String relativePath = distribName + "/" + destFile.getName(); destFile = new File(relativePath); FileSystem.copyFile(new File(filename),destFile); } String tarFileName = String.format("%s.tar", distribName); Runtime r = Runtime.getRuntime(); Process p = r.exec(String.format("tar -cf %s %s/", tarFileName, distribName)); if(p.waitFor() == 0) { File tarFile = new File(tarFileName); FileSystem.gzipFile(tarFile, new File(tarFileName + ".gz")); tarFile.delete(); FileSystem.deleteDir(new File(distribName)); lastCreatedDistribution = distribName; return true; } else { System.err.printf("%s: Unable to create tar file %s\n", this.getClass().getName(),tarFileName); } } catch (IOException e) { System.err.printf("%s: Unable to add file %s to distribution %s\n", this.getClass().getName(),currentFile,distribName); } catch (InterruptedException e) { System.err.printf("%s: tar did not return from building %s.tar\n", this.getClass().getName(),distribName); throw new RuntimeInterruptedException(e); } } else { System.err.printf("%s: Unable to create temp directory %s\n", this.getClass().getName(), distribName); } return false; } @Override public String toString() { String header = String.format("Distributable package %s (%d files)\n", lastCreatedDistribution,distFiles.size()); StringBuilder sb = new StringBuilder(header); sb.append("--------------------------------------------------------------------\n"); for(String filename : distFiles) sb.append(String.format(" %s\n", filename)); return sb.toString(); } }
